George C. Junkin was a member of the Nebraska House of Representatives. He was from Iowa.[1] Junkin also served as Secretary of State in Nebraska. He was a Republican. Junkin was born in Salina, Iowa on June 9, 1858. He married Emma Swinburne of Delhi, Iowa in 1885. They had two sons and one daughter.[1]
